The following changes since commit
bb3c90f0de7b34995b5e35cf5dc97a3d428b3761:

  Merge branch 'for-linus' of git://git390.marist.edu/pub/scm/linux-2.6 (2011-04-08 07:36:14 -0700)

are available in the git repository at:

  git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/jbarnes/pci-2.6 for-linus

Just one rather low priority fix for one of the patches that went in
this cycle.

Randy Dunlap (1):
      PCI: pci-label: Fix build failure when CONFIG_NLS is set to 'm' by allmodconfig

 drivers/pci/Kconfig  |    4 +++-
 drivers/pci/Makefile |    4 ++--
 2 files changed, 5 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)
